500-Hour Acupressure Professional Program


     Our 500-hour Acupressure Professional Program essentially combines our 250-hour Advanced Acupressure Practitioner Program, along with your choice one of our 250-hour Professional Specialization Programs. In this format students can meet both the hours (500) and subject area requirements necessary to apply for the California Massage Therapy Council's (CAMTC) Voluntary Certification as a Certified Massage Therapist. Further, if a student chooses they can focus their program by selecting from our recommended class list, and also be able to apply to become a Professional Member of the American Organization for the Bodywork Therapies of Asia (AOBTA), and/or take the National Certification Exam in Asian Bodywork Therapy (ABT) offered by the National Certification Commission for Acupuncture and Oriental Medicine (NCCAOM). This program can help one achieve both professional status and the highest level of certification currently available efficiently and effectively.

    To complete your 500-hr Acupressure Professional Program choose one of these 3 options-

OPTION 1:
1)   150-hour Basic Acupressure Program
2)   100-hour Advanced Acupressure Supplement
3)   250-hour Professional Specialization Program.

The first two steps of this option allow a student to meet the hours (250) and subject area requirements necessary to apply for the California Massage Therapy Council’s (CAMTC) Voluntary Certification as a Certified Massage Practitioner.  With the addition one of our Professional Specialization 250-hour Programs, students can meet the requirements necessary to apply for the CAMTC’s Voluntary Certification as a Certified Massage Therapist.  

In addition, completion of this option allows one to apply for-

1.   Membership as a Certified Practitioner of the American Organization for Bodywork Therapies of Asia (AOBTA). Application and membership fees apply.

2.  The highest membership in the Associated Bodywork and Massage Professionals (ABMP), as an ABMP Certified Therapist, once CAMTC Certification is received.  Membership fees apply. ABMP membership can provide professional liability insurance for an additional fee.

3.  To take the Asian Bodywork Therapy (ABT) exam given by the National Certification Commission for Acupuncture and Oriental Medicine (NCCAOM).  Students who wish to take this exam should take the 250-hour Professional Specialization Program with their Specialization Area being Asian Bodywork Therapy, with elective classes being those recommended for preparation for the ABT exam. Application fees, test fees, and certification fees apply. (ABT recommended class list)

Additional requirements to be met for AOBTA and NCCAOM.
1.  First Aid class and CPR class for NCCAOM and AOBTA requirements
2.  Ten sessions from AOBTA Certified Instructors for AOBTA requirements


OPTION 2:
1)   150-hour Basic Acupressure Program
2)   100 hours of Advanced Classes or Elective classes not previously taken
3)   250-hour Professional Specialization Program.

This option is for those who wish to practice Acupressure in California, but are not interested in certification via CAMTC and/or NCCAOM. Certification is not presently required for acupressure professional practice in the State of California (although some cities/counties may require CAMTC certification.)  This option is well suited for self-development and for those learning to work on family and friends.  This option is also well suited for those who have 100 hours of Anatomy and Physiology from other schools.
In addition, completion of this option allows one to-

1.  Apply for membership in the American Organization for Bodywork Therapies of Asia (AOBTA).
Application and membership fees apply.
2.  Apply for Professional Level Membership in ABMP. Membership fees apply. ABMP membership can provide professional liability insurance for an additional fee.


OPTION 3:
Two 250-hour Professional Specialization Programs

This option is well suited for students who come to the Acupressure Institute with other massage, bodywork, or energy work training. 

In addition, completion of this option allows one to-

Apply for certification as a Certified Massage Therapist, as long as they meet the requirement of 100 hours of Anatomy & Physiology, Ethics, Heath, Hygiene, and Contraindications.  If a student meets these requirements via other schools or includes these requirements in their two Professional Specialization 250-hour programs, the student may also be eligible to apply for the certifications and professional organization memberships listed above.
